src_configure() {
	# Keep this in sync with app-misc/c_rehash
	SSL_CNF_DIR="/etc/ssl"

	# Quiet out unknown driver argument warnings since openssl
	# doesn't have well-split CFLAGS and we're making it even worse
	# and 'make depend' uses -Werror for added fun (bug #417795 again)
	tc-is-clang && append-flags -Qunused-arguments

	# We really, really need to build OpenSSL w/ strict aliasing disabled.
	# It's filled with violations and it *will* result in miscompiled
	# code. This has been in the ebuild for > 10 years but even in 2022,
	# it's still relevant:
	# - https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/issues/55255
	# - https://github.com/openssl/openssl/issues/18225
	# - https://github.com/openssl/openssl/issues/18663#issuecomment-1181478057
	# Don't remove the no strict aliasing bits below!
	filter-flags -fstrict-aliasing
	append-flags -fno-strict-aliasing
	# The OpenSSL developers don't test with LTO right now, it leads to various
	# warnings/errors (which may or may not be false positives), it's considered
	# unsupported, and it's not tested in CI: https://github.com/openssl/openssl/issues/18663.
	filter-lto

	append-flags $(test-flags-CC -Wa,--noexecstack)

	# bug #197996
	unset APPS
	# bug #312551
	unset SCRIPTS
	# bug #311473
	unset CROSS_COMPILE

	tc-export AR CC CXX RANLIB RC

	multilib-minimal_src_configure
}

multilib_src_install() {
	emake DESTDIR="${D}" install_sw
	if use fips; then
		emake DESTDIR="${D}" install_fips
		# Regen this in pkg_preinst, bug 900625
		rm "${ED}${SSL_CNF_DIR}"/fipsmodule.cnf || die
	fi

	if multilib_is_native_abi; then
		emake DESTDIR="${D}" install_ssldirs
		emake DESTDIR="${D}" DOCDIR='$(INSTALLTOP)'/share/doc/${PF} install_docs
	fi

	# This is crappy in that the static archives are still built even
	# when USE=static-libs. But this is due to a failing in the openssl
	# build system: the static archives are built as PIC all the time.
	# Only way around this would be to manually configure+compile openssl
	# twice; once with shared lib support enabled and once without.
	if ! use static-libs ; then
		rm "${ED}"/usr/$(get_libdir)/lib{crypto,ssl}.a || die
	fi
}
